Who is “Frasier Canceled”?

“Frasier,” a beloved American sitcom, was recently canceled after its second season on Paramount+. The show, a reboot of the popular 1990s television series, was met with great anticipation from fans of the original. However, it has now officially ended due to various production and viewership challenges. Let’s dive into the details of the show’s cancellation, the reasons behind it, and what this means for fans.

The original Frasier series, which aired from 1993 to 2004, was a beloved sitcom featuring Kelsey Grammer as Dr. Frasier Crane, a neurotic psychiatrist. The show was a spin-off from the highly successful series Cheers, which helped launch Frasier Crane as a character. The reboot of Frasier, which began airing in 2023 on Paramount+, followed Grammer’s character once again as he navigated life in a new city, while reintroducing old characters and relationships. The reboot was highly anticipated but ultimately canceled after two seasons due to disappointing viewership numbers.

While Frasier the character had an extensive history before the reboot, the reboot itself was created with hopes of capturing a new audience. The creative team behind the reboot, led by Chris Harris, wanted to stay true to the essence of the original series while modernizing it for today’s TV landscape. The reboot’s cancellation is a testament to how difficult it can be to live up to the success of a beloved show, especially when trying to cater to both long-time fans and a younger generation unfamiliar with the franchise.

Career of Kelsey Grammer and the Frasier Franchise

Kelsey Grammer’s career began in the early 1980s, and he quickly rose to prominence with his portrayal of Frasier Crane on Cheers. His success on Cheers ultimately led to the creation of Frasier, a spin-off that ran for 11 seasons and cemented Grammer as a television icon. Throughout the years, his portrayal of Frasier earned him numerous awards, including multiple Emmys and Golden Globe Awards.

After the original Frasier series ended in 2004, Grammer’s career took various paths, including a mix of television and film work. He appeared in the critically acclaimed series The Simpsons as the voice of Sideshow Bob and in a variety of other shows and films. Grammer also ventured into producing and directing, taking on behind-the-scenes roles in addition to his acting career.

The 2023 reboot of Frasier marked the return of Grammer to the character that had made him a household name. Although the reboot was met with a great deal of anticipation, it struggled to maintain the momentum of its predecessor. It ultimately failed to capture the audience’s attention in the same way, leading to its cancellation after two seasons.

While the cancellation of Frasier (2023) is a setback for the franchise, it doesn’t take away from the legacy that both the original series and Grammer’s portrayal of Frasier Crane left in the television industry. The reboot, despite its short run, allowed fans to relive the iconic character once again, and gave new audiences the opportunity to experience a piece of television history.

Latest News: Frasier Reboot’s Cancellation

The “Frasier” reboot has officially been canceled after two seasons on Paramount+. Despite hopes for a continuation of the beloved series, the show did not meet the network’s viewership expectations. In January 2025, it was confirmed that no third season would be produced, and the show will be shopped to other networks in hopes of finding a new home. Fans were disappointed by the news, and many are left wondering if the series will find a way to continue, either on a new network or with new formats. There are no current plans for the franchise beyond this, leaving the fate of the reboot uncertain.
